Rightmove has seen the very best variety of gross sales agreed within the full month of July since 2020, on account of “savvy summer time sellers” being extra practical in regards to the asking worth of their houses.

Summer season vacation distractions historically lead to an August worth drop, RM says, with common new vendor asking costs dropping by a seasonal 1.3% (-£4,969) this month to £368,740. August’s worth drop is consistent with the earlier ten-year common, it provides, returning to seasonal developments after larger than normal asking worth drops in June and July.

The common new vendor asking worth for a house has now fallen by £10,777 this summer time however the report factors out that there are nonetheless a big variety of distributors coming to market with a too-high preliminary worth. One-in-three houses have undergone a worth discount throughout advertising and marketing.

Colleen Babcock, property skilled at Rightmove, mentioned: “Savvy summer time sellers have learn the room and are coming to market with much more aggressive pricing than normal to actually stand out and appeal to severe and energetic patrons. Astute patrons are actually benefitting from new vendor asking costs that are on common an attractive £10,000 cheaper than three months in the past. Consumers have the higher hand on this high-supply market, so a tempting worth is important to agree a sale.”

“The technique is working, with the variety of gross sales agreed within the full month of July being one of the best presently of yr since 2020. Our information reveals that for a profitable sale it’s higher to get the worth proper within the first place, but when a vendor does want to scale back the worth it’s higher to behave quick somewhat than ready too lengthy.”

The information reveals that the variety of out there houses on the market is 10% increased than presently final yr, holding the amount of houses on the market at a decade excessive. The variety of gross sales being agreed is now 8% increased than presently final yr.

A “two-speed” market is changing into extra evident, the report goes on to say: the place a property doesn’t want a worth discount, the common time to discover a purchaser is 32 days. But when a house has wanted a worth discount from its authentic itemizing, this common time to discover a purchaser greater than triples, to 99 days.

Rightmove’s each day mortgage tracker reveals that purchaser affordability has been bettering, with the common two-year fastened mortgage charge now 4.49%, in contrast with 5.17% presently final yr, equating to a month-to-month saving of £117 monthly for somebody taking out a two-year fastened mortgage on the common dwelling, primarily based on having a 20% deposit and spreading the mortgage over 30 years.  expects some additional small mortgage charge reductions over the following few weeks however no main drops.

Matt Smith, Rightmove’s mortgages skilled, commented: “It was optimistic to see final week’s third Base Fee minimize of the yr, however the supporting commentary from the Financial institution of England suggests the chance for additional cuts has narrowed. The markets are at the moment forecasting yet one more minimize earlier than the tip of the yr. Lenders have moved their charges downwards to stay aggressive, however there doesn’t seem like a lot room for too many additional reductions if present market forecasts play out. We may probably see some lenders squeeze their margin to realize a aggressive benefit, however I don’t suppose this could play out throughout the market and would possible goal particular segments of movers. Total, with additional information to be releases and exterior occasions to play out, I feel it’s possible charges will stay just about flat from right here, with solely small actions up or down.”
